This binding is already covered by fsl,mpc8xxx-pci.yaml schema. While
the MPC512x is mentioned here, its compatible strings aren't actually
documented and remain that way.

-* Freescale 83xx and 512x PCI bridges
-
-Freescale 83xx and 512x SOCs include the same PCI bridge core.
-
-83xx/512x specific notes:
-- reg: should contain two address length tuples
-    The first is for the internal PCI bridge registers
-    The second is for the PCI config space access registers
-
-Example (MPC8313ERDB)
-	pci0: pci@e0008500 {
-		interrupt-map-mask = <0xf800 0x0 0x0 0x7>;
-		interrupt-map = <
-				/* IDSEL 0x0E -mini PCI */
-				 0x7000 0x0 0x0 0x1 &ipic 18 0x8
-				 0x7000 0x0 0x0 0x2 &ipic 18 0x8
-				 0x7000 0x0 0x0 0x3 &ipic 18 0x8
-				 0x7000 0x0 0x0 0x4 &ipic 18 0x8
-
-				/* IDSEL 0x0F - PCI slot */
-				 0x7800 0x0 0x0 0x1 &ipic 17 0x8
-				 0x7800 0x0 0x0 0x2 &ipic 18 0x8
-				 0x7800 0x0 0x0 0x3 &ipic 17 0x8
-				 0x7800 0x0 0x0 0x4 &ipic 18 0x8>;
-		interrupt-parent = <&ipic>;
-		interrupts = <66 0x8>;
-		bus-range = <0x0 0x0>;
-		ranges = <0x02000000 0x0 0x90000000 0x90000000 0x0 0x10000000
-			  0x42000000 0x0 0x80000000 0x80000000 0x0 0x10000000
-			  0x01000000 0x0 0x00000000 0xe2000000 0x0 0x00100000>;
-		clock-frequency = <66666666>;
-		#interrupt-cells = <1>;
-		#size-cells = <2>;
-		#address-cells = <3>;
-		reg = <0xe0008500 0x100		/* internal registers */
-		       0xe0008300 0x8>;		/* config space access registers */
-		compatible = "fsl,mpc8349-pci";
-		device_type = "pci";
-	};
